A study conducted
out of Rush University Medical
Center found that when older adults
ate diets high in fruits and vegetables and low in refined sugar and saturated fats, they were less likely to be depressed than those who
ate diets high in red meat and processed, sugary foods.

According to a study in the Journal
of Behavior Research and Therapy, researchers from the Pennington Biomedical Research
Center in Los Angeles found
out that people who
ate quickly tended to
eat more food compared to people who
ate at a slower pace.
